For those of us who didn't grow up with the love of nature, the idea of nature study sounds like a wonderful thing, something we want to give our children.

0:09.0

But we might find ourselves at a loss once we step outside that front door.

0:14.0

Or, well, we might have all those nature journals in tow with us, but when our children's faces just turn expectantly toward us, what do we say?

0:23.6

What do we do?

0:25.2

Well, let's get specific.

0:31.1

Welcome to the Simply Charlotte Mason podcast.

0:35.7

I'm Sonia Schaefer.

0:37.1

Joining me today is my friend Amber O'Neill Johnston, who is a self-avowed lover of air conditioning when she grew up, right?

0:45.3

Yes, that is totally me. I would say this is one of the most intimidating parts of a Charlotte Mason education for me was this idea of intentionally going outside and staying there.

0:58.2

I grew up in the country and we spent a lot of time outside, but it wasn't studying nature.

1:05.8

It wasn't like, I mean, I could recognize the Red Wing Blackbird because they were all over the place,

1:28.5

but it wasn't like I knew all of the birds and all of the flowers and all of the weeds. And, yeah, we didn't look at it that way. It was just we were out there playing. Yeah. Well, for me, it wasn't even that, right? So my time outside was spent from the car to the building, from the building to the car. And outside was kind of in my family culture. It was something to be avoided. And so this idea

1:34.4

that I would spend time outside, that's layer one. And then actually study the things that I see

1:40.4

out there was a whole other layer. And I wanted that desperately for my kids, but I think a lot of times in this community,

1:47.3

we can tend to assume that people are starting from a certain place.

1:51.5

And I think it's great for someone to acknowledge, and I'll be the first that I started

1:56.4

from zero, not knowing anything.

1:59.5

And I remember someone suggesting, why don't you guys just go on a short

2:02.1

hike? And I was like, where do you do that? And she was like, just go to the trailhead and walk,

2:07.0

and then you guys can meander. I was like, where is a trailhead? I'm looking for a sign.

2:12.5

Yes. Trailhead turn here. So I was like, I need you to talk to me as if you can't even imagine that I don't know anything. I know how to go to the playground and the park. It was boring. My kids weren't after they were two or three. They were tired of that looking for expansion. And one of the best things I did was join a nature group. And I did that because I had no idea what else to do.

2:36.6

But the mom that was in charge of that, she was the Charlotte Mason mom, and she led us so well.
